ikon.5 architects has been once again named to the “Architect 50”, a list of top architectural practices in the United States put together by Architect magazine, the official journal of the American Institute of Architects. Now in its fifth year, the highly competitive contest ranks architecture firms across the country according to a number of criteria, including business, sustainability and design. This year ikon.5 was ranked ‘6th Best in Design’ and ‘13th Best Overall’, besting some formidable practices nationwide.

Of the categories ranked by the survey, design is the most competitive, requiring firms to submit a portfolio of completed projects to be judged by a panel of esteemed architects drawn from the academy and practice. This year’s judges including Florian Idenburg, founding partner of the New York-based SO-IL, who previously worked eight years at the Pritzker Prize winning practice, SANAA; Sharon Johnston, AIA, founder and principal of the Los-Angeles based practice Johnston Marklee; and Dan Maginin, FAIA, principal of the Kansas City, Missouri based firm El Dorado.

About ikon.5 the jury said “ikon.5 architects rocketed to the top of the list of the best firms in the country thanks mostly to its strong design portfolio. Clear and elegant design solutions harnessing structure, material and light toward singular timeless work on relatively tight budgets”, said the jury.

“This distinction of being recognized by one’s peers is truly an honor,” said Joseph G. Tattoni, AIA, design principal of ikon.5 architects. “We are particularly proud to be the only New Jersey firm listed. “We thank our staff and our clients for their part in making this happen.”

In addition to being named one of the top design practices in the United States, ikon.5 architects was recognized with 12 national and international design awards in 2014 bringing the firm’s total earnings of awards to more than 70 in ten years of practice.

About ikon.5 architects

Formed in 2003 and located in Princeton, NJ, ikon.5 architects is a broad-based practice in architecture, planning, landscape and interior design with a portfolio of projects serving higher education, non-profit organizations, cultural institutions and business global business corporations. A national practice, the firm has been recognized with more than 50 international, national and state design awards for creative solutions that contribute to the enrichment of the built environment.
